On or about page 5 is an embedded EMF, captioned "Figure 1". There's no indication that it's an EMF (is there?), but when I right-click on it and select "Save Graphics", there are a plethora of formats as which I may apparently save it. Problem: only some of the file formats work. For instance, if I select SVG, GIF, or EPS, a file is created in the file system, but it is zero bytes. Conversely, I can select BMP or PNG and a file is saved, that is apparently correct as viewed by an outside program.
